9 | ####################################################################### |
10 | # | |
11 | # Master machine independent configuration file. | |
12 | # | |
13 | # Specific configuration files are created based on this and | |
14 | # the machine specific master file using the doconf script. | |
15 | # | |
16 | # Any changes to the master configuration files will affect all | |
17 | # other configuration files based upon it. | |
18 | # | |
19 | ####################################################################### | |
20 | # | |
21 | # To build a configuration, execute "doconf <configuration>." | |
22 | # Configurations are specified in the "Configurations:" section | |
23 | # of the MASTER and MASTER.* files as follows: | |
24 | # | |
25 | # <configuration> = [ <attribute0> <attribute1> ... <attributeN> ] | |
26 | # | |
27 | # Lines in the MASTER and MASTER.* files are selected based on | |
28 | # the attribute selector list, found in a comment at the end of | |
29 | # the line. This is a list of attributes separated by commas. | |
30 | # The "!" operator selects the line if none of the attributes are | |
31 | # specified. | |
32 | # | |
33 | # For example: | |
34 | # | |
35 | # <foo,bar> selects a line if "foo" or "bar" are specified. | |
36 | # <!foo,bar> selects a line if neither "foo" nor "bar" is | |
37 | # specified. | |
38 | # | |
39 | # Lines with no attributes specified are selected for all | |
40 | # configurations. | |
41 | # | |

cb323159 A |
199 | # configurable vfs related resources |
200 | # CONFIG_VNODES - used to pre allocate vnode related resources | |
2d21ac55 A |
201 | # CONFIG_NC_HASH - name cache hash table allocation |
202 | # CONFIG_VFS_NAMES - name strings | |
203 | # | |
cb323159 A |
204 | # 263168 magic number for medium CONFIG_VNODES is based on memory |
205 | # Number vnodes is (memsize/64k) + 1024 | |
2d21ac55 | 206 | # This is the calculation that is used by launchd in tiger |
cb323159 | 207 | # we are clipping the max based on 16G |
2d21ac55 A |
208 | # ie ((16*1024*1024*1024)/(64 *1024)) + 1024 = 263168; |

582 | # | |
583 | # This defines configuration options that are normally used only during | |
584 | # kernel code development and debugging. They add run-time error checks or | |
585 | # statistics gathering, which will slow down the system | |
586 | # | |
587 | ########################################################## | |
588 | # | |
589 | # MACH_ASSERT controls the assert() and ASSERT() macros, used to verify the | |
590 | # consistency of various algorithms in the kernel. The performance impact | |
591 | # of this option is significant. | |
592 | # | |
593 | options MACH_ASSERT # # <mach_assert> | |
594 | # | |
595 | # MACH_DEBUG enables the mach_debug_server, a message interface used to | |
596 | # retrieve or control various statistics. This interface may expose data | |
597 | # structures that would not normally be allowed outside the kernel, and | |
598 | # MUST NOT be enabled on a released configuration. | |
599 | # Other options here enable information retrieval for specific subsystems | |
600 | # | |
601 | options MACH_DEBUG # IPC debugging interface # <mdebug> | |
602 | options MACH_IPC_DEBUG # Enable IPC debugging calls # <ipc_debug> | |
3e170ce0 | 603 | options MACH_VM_DEBUG # # <debug> |
fe8ab488 A |
604 | # |
605 | # MACH_MP_DEBUG control the possible dead locks that may occur by controlling | |
606 | # that IPL level has been raised down to SPL0 after some calls to | |
607 | # hardclock device driver. | |
608 | # | |
